History
For more than 60 years, the University of Kansas Life Span Institute at Parsons has
- Partnered with national, state, regional, and community partners,
- Conducted research,
- Developed model service programs,
- Provided training for professionals involved in services to young children, youth and adults with disabilities, and their families.
The Parsons LSI includes a component of the Kansas University Center on Excellence in Developmental Disabilities (KUCDD) and the Parsons Research Center.
